This edited book is a rich and diverse collection of chapters examining the educational transitions of marginalized and multilingual migrant youth across six countries in Northern Europe. Contributions analyze and discuss the transitions from intersectional perspectives such as religion, nationality, socio-economic condition, gender, and language. This intersection of background, personal, societal, cultural, and educational variables emphasize the need to remove barriers and adapt educational spaces to be more inclusive and socially just. The book will be of interest to students and academics in education, child and youth studies, migration studies, sociology and sociolinguistics.
Anna-Lena Borg is Senior Lecturer in the Department of Social and Behavioural Studies, University West, Sweden.
Helene Fransson is a PhD student in the Department of Education, Communication and Learning, University of Gothenburg, Sweden.
Renata Emilsson Peskova is Associate Professor in the School of Education, University of Iceland.
